I received this grinder as a gift about 6 months ago. I am a welder and complain often about my corded grinder(which is a beast) because I have leads, ground cables, and other trip hazards around so the last thing I want is another cord to trip on.
I specialize in stairs and railings which, as you can imagine need to be clean as clean can be prior to paint or powder. I run, on average, 4-8 4 AH packs through this little guy 5-6 days a week so I believe at this point, I'm a qualified opinion.
Weight and Balance: Light weight. I actually think it's almost a little too light. I run the 4 AH packs partly for runtime, but also for heft. I like the balance better with the bigger pack. It's by no means bad with the smaller packs but my personal taste is to run the 4's.
Durability: This thing is beaten daily and still runs like new. No head noises, no loss of power. I have had 0 issues with the switch. Through steel, aluminum, and stainless it just grinds away.
There is visible wear on the rubber coating(meaning it's now smooth) which is to be expected with the level of use. It's been dropped, had things dropped on it, and even took a bath in Monster one day and it just keeps on ticking.
Battery life: I use everything from cuttoff wheels to flapdiscs, hard discs to sanding pads. Sanding pads by far have the greatest battery life. Cuttof wheels last forever if you're cutting light gauge, but it eats them cutting thick stuff. I break out the corded if cutting 1/4 or thicker. Flapdiscs are in the middle of the road and hard discs aren't bad as long as you don't lay on it. If you push the heck out of it, it's not too great.
Brake: This is great. I save my pads, and my table because I'm not constantly stopping the head on the table. It also doesn't kick much at all when the tool catches.
Guard: It's a guard. I'm sure it works however I can't speak on that. It's easy to take off(*DISCLAIMER: I recommend always using a guard when possible.) For my purposes a guard on any grinder is in my way. Mine is still shiny, unlike the rest of the grinder.
Summary: All in all a great grinder and a good purchase. My title says I will buy again because I will eventually wear it out. Judging by how it has performed, I'm guessing that won't be for a long time unless I drop something big on it. Good job Dewalt. Solid tool as always.

[This review was collected as part of a promotion.] This is my second 20V Max grinder. I own the DCG412B as well. This one is longer, but I find that it is at last easier to hold, and better balanced. My favorite part is that it has a "soft" brake when you let off the paddle. It spins the wheel down gently, yet quite quickly. The gearing that provides the angle transmission seem to mesh better than the gears in my other tool. This one is smoother and quieter.
Clearly this one has more power and spins faster as well. I haven't burned through a whole battery in one go yet, so I can't comment on runtime just yet, but it obviously isn't worse than my other tool. And of course I expect it to be better because, XR.
